Is Graceland in debt?

Graceland failed to pay off $20million of $104million issued by the economic development agency (EDGE) for a mass expansion project in 2017. It comes as the owner Lisa Marie Presley died after suffering a cardiac arrest yesterday aged 54, sparking questions over who will get the mansion.

Does Graceland still make money?

According to Forbes, Elvis Presley's estate makes him one of the wealthiest dead celebrities today. The publication estimates that the Presley estate earned $23 million in 2020 alone. A majority of this money comes in through Graceland, which earns around $10 million annually during a typical year.

How much is Lisa Marie Presley in debt for?

Lisa Marie Presley struggled with her finances throughout much of her life. After her $100 million Elvis Presley estate inheritance was squandered away by bad business dealings and a shady manager, Lisa Marie found herself in debt to the tune of $4 million at the time of her death at the age of 54.

How much is Graceland worth today?

Brown / Getty Images / AFP. Over the years, the trustees decided to open Graceland up to the public via a variety of tours and overnight stays. Elvis purchased the home in 1957 for $US100,000 ($A143,500). In 2020, Rolling Stone reported its estimated worth to be as much as $US500 million ($A718 million).

Is Lisa Marie still wealthy?

Somewhat shockingly, Lisa Marie Presley's net worth in 2023 was estimated to be $-16 million. Lisa Marie sold an 85% stake in Elvis Presley Enterprises to CKX, the same company that owned American Idol, in 2005, but the business venture failed.

How much did Elvis give for Graceland?

In the spring of 1957, when Elvis Presley was 22, he purchased the home and grounds for just over $100,000. The previous year had been a whirlwind - it was Elvis' first year of super-stardom including historic network television appearances, record-breaking live performances and armloads of gold record awards.

Did Elvis pay his band well?

While Presley's star rose, his band remained on a fixed salary, causing increasing dissension. In a joint interview with The Memphis Press-Scimitar in late 1956, his three sidemen said they were being paid $200 a week when on tour (the article called that “good money for sidemen”) and $100 a week the rest of the time.

How much money did Tom Parker take from Elvis?

It was the beginning of a staggering run of chart-toppers that would last into the early '60s. Presley's fame came at a price, though, with Parker taking up to 50% of the singer's earnings, whereas most managers took 10 to 15%.

Is Graceland left untouched?

The King of Rock and Roll died upstairs at Graceland and to this day it's off-limits to the public. However, Elvis Presley's private area is still perfectly preserved at his daughter Lisa Marie's request. It's the job of Director of Archives Angie Marchese to maintain Elvis' bedroom and other rooms just as he left it.
